Jeremiah 4:5-7
Wycliffe Bible
5 Tell ye in Judah, and make ye heard in Jerusalem; speak ye, and sing ye with a trump in the land; cry ye strongly, and say ye, Be ye gathered together, and enter we into [the] strong cities.
6 Raise ye a sign in Zion, comfort ye, and do not ye stand (Raise ye up a sign in Zion, escape ye, and do not ye just stand there); for I [shall] bring evil from the north, and a great sorrow.
7 A lion shall go up from his den, and the robber of folks shall raise himself. He is gone out of his place, to set thy land into wilderness; thy cities shall be destroyed, abiding still without (a) dweller. (A lion shall go up from his den, yea, the robber of the nations shall raise himself up. He is gone out of his place, to make thy land into a wilderness; thy cities shall be destroyed, and their remains, or their ruins, shall be without any inhabitants.)

Jeremiah 4:5-7
New International Version
Disaster From the North
5 “Announce in Judah and proclaim(A) in Jerusalem and say:
‘Sound the trumpet(B) throughout the land!’
Cry aloud and say:
‘Gather together!
Let us flee to the fortified cities!’(C)
6 Raise the signal(D) to go to Zion!
Flee for safety without delay!
For I am bringing disaster(E) from the north,(F)
even terrible destruction.”
